In the process of natural disaster emergency rescue,emergency logistics often encounter power disruption, communication base station damage and other unfavorable situation, resulting in the broken instant communication between transport vehicles and command center.The command center unable to understand the transport vehicles, road real-time situation, Efficiency of rescue.In order to guarantee the reliability of instant communication between the emergency vehicles and the command center in the disaster area, according to the bad communication problems in the emergent logistics, combining with 4G, Wifi and Beidou communications,according to the network signal strength and user demands of different communication situation, this paper research and development of a multi-mode communication middleware. The middleware system includes seven communication modes, which can be applied to the car terminal in the form of plug-ins, and other emergency communication systems.In this paper, the use of UML class diagram analyses the Android network communication architecture, 4G, Wifi and the Beidou communication principle, and the relevant source code of communication part in Android system. Aiming at the problems and application scenarios in emergent logistics, the multimode communication architecture is designed from the aspects of software and hardware, and the multimode communication middleware library is developed by using the key technologies such as WebSocket, Compass communication, AIDL process communication and Bcrypt encryption. By using this library, the terminal software of the emergency ripe grain was developed and the terminal performance was tested by using the Monkey automated testing tool. The requirement of the emergency ripe grain vehicle terminal communication system was achieved and the validity of the middleware was verified. The reliability of emergency logistics instant communication system is improved. At the same time the multi-mode communication middleware is also worthy to be applied to the communication system which is highly demanded in real-time and stability.
